How much do augmented reality develop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for augmented reality developer in Seattle, WA is $61.43,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$47.07 and $71.11 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an augmented reality developer?

An Augmented Reality (AR) Developer is responsible for designing, developing, and implementing AR experiences using technologies like ARKit, ARCore, and Unity. They create interactive digital overlays that enhance the real-world environment for applications in gaming, education, retail, and more. AR Developers work with 3D modeling, computer vision, and programming languages like C# or JavaScript. Their role involves optimizing AR applications for performance, usability, and cross-platform compatibility.

What are some common challenges augmented reality developers face in their daily work?

Augmented Reality Developers often encounter challenges such as optimizing AR applications for various devices with different hardware capabilities, ensuring smooth real-time rendering, and addressing issues with user interaction and spatial tracking. Staying up to date with rapidly evolving AR technology and platforms, as well as debugging complex issues that can arise from integrating 3D assets and sensor data, is also common. Collaboration with designers, artists, and UX specialists is frequent, requiring effective communication to transform creative visions into technically feasible solutions. Overcoming these challenges is a key part of creating immersive and user-friendly AR experiences.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an augmented reality developer?

To thrive as an Augmented Reality Developer, you need strong programming skills (C#, C++, or JavaScript), a solid grasp of 3D modeling concepts, and experience with AR platforms like ARKit, ARCore, or Unity3D, often supported by a relevant deg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ency in using development environments such as Unity or Unreal Engine and familiarity with mobile app deployment are essential, with certifications in AR development offering a competitive edge. Creativity, problem-solving, and effective collaboration are important soft skills for turning ideas into interactive AR experiences and working within multidisciplinary teams. These abilities are crucial for delivering engaging, functional AR applications that integrate seamlessly with both user needs and technological advancements.
